Best Practices for Protecting Your Data

Change Your Password Immediately

Navigating the T33n Leak: A Comprehensive Guide for Affected Individuals

If your Twitter account was affected by the T33n Leak, it is essential to change your password immediately. Do not reuse any passwords you have used before.

Use Strong Passwords

Create strong passwords using a combination of upper and lowercase letters, numbers, and symbols. Avoid using common words or personal information. Consider using a password manager to help you generate and store secure passwords.

Enable Two-Factor Authentication (2FA)

Enable 2FA on all your important accounts, including Twitter. 2FA adds an extra layer of security by requiring you to provide a verification code sent to your phone or email when you log in.

Limit Personal Information Sharing

Avoid sharing sensitive personal information, such as your Social Security number, birthdate, or full address, on social media.

Be Wary of Phishing Emails

Phishing emails are fraudulent emails that appear to come from legitimate sources and attempt to trick you into revealing your personal information. Be suspicious of emails that ask you to click on links or provide your password.

Monitor Your Credit Report

Monitor your credit report regularly for any suspicious activity. If you notice any unauthorized charges or accounts, contact your creditors immediately.

Consider Freezing Your Credit

Freezing your credit can prevent unauthorized access to your credit files and limit the potential for financial fraud.
